What is the name of the serpent defeated by Thor in Norse mythology? 🔊
The name of the serpent defeated by Thor in Norse mythology is Jörmungandr, also known as the Midgard Serpent. This formidable creature encircles the Earth and is prophesied to engage in a cataclysmic battle with Thor during Ragnarök. Their conflict exemplifies the eternal struggle between chaos and order, as Thor seeks to protect the realms from Jörmungandr's destructive potential. Additionally, this serpentine figure symbolizes the deep connections between the sea and the world of gods in Norse belief, highlighting complex themes in their mythology.
